Retrieval before rereading

Begin without notes so the task measures accessible knowledge. Close the lesson and reconstruct the central idea before checking the source. This distinguishes accessible knowledge from simple familiarity. Avoid turning the exercise into more copying. The goal is to improve what can be retrieved, compared, or explained when the source is not visible. The learner should be able to identify both progress and uncertainty.

Teach-back

Use the result to select the next review target. Explain a difficult concept aloud in plain language. Hesitation or vague wording shows where understanding needs another pass. Compare the first attempt with the educational source and correct only the missing or inaccurate point. Retest that point later without looking. This gives self-paced study a measurable objective.

Separate confidence from accuracy

For learners using the Santiago De Los Caballeros page, Rate confidence before answering a retrieval prompt and compare the rating with actual accuracy. High confidence with a weak answer identifies material that feels familiar but needs active review. Record the outcome so the next study session begins with a specific objective.
